## Audit-Log Viewer API

Plugin authors can pull audit events straight from the Glimview viewer API instead of scraping the UI (please don't scrape the UI). Events are paginated in batches of 500 and filterable by actor, action, and time window; timestamps are always UTC. Note that redacted fields show up as null, not empty strings — a few plugins have tripped on that. Rate limits are generous but real: 60 requests per minute per key. Authenticate every request with the internal service key below.

gateway credential: kto3_qfe

Subject: Log sampling cut-over complete — Burrowd

Plugin authors: the Burrowd core now samples debug logs instead of emitting everything. Cut-over finished last night with no dropped error-level events. Plugins inheriting the core logger get sampling automatically; override per-plugin if you need full verbosity during development. Expect quieter output in shared environments. The sampler now runs with these settings.

settings of yageg-yahap:
[gorael]
team = olieth
access_code = ac_941d74
owner = brieth.aldiel
host = gorael.tolvaqio.internal
port = 6379
peer = briwyn.urlaqtech.internal
salt = 116e6622
pin = 1957

Current provider Caddon Freight has missed SLA four consecutive months; penalty clauses exhausted. Recommendation: transition to Norfell Logistics, phased over eight weeks, starting with the Westbrey depot. Cost neutral in year one, projected 9% saving thereafter. Risks: short-term delivery variance, one-off migration cost, retraining warehouse staff on Norfell's tracking platform. Mitigations in place; contract draft reviewed by legal. Customer comms held until signature. Strategic rationale, board eyes only, is appended below.

management briefing: The renewal with Quenaelox Group closes at $2 million a year, 15 percent below the last contract. Project Holwyn slips by six weeks because of the tooling delay.

Runbook fragment — account recovery after the Brindlecache incident. Following the stale-cache postmortem, recovery now forces a cache purge before reissuing sessions. As a contractor, run the purge script first, confirm the user's profile timestamp is fresh, then reissue credentials. If the recovery console itself is locked from the incident, unlock it with the passphrase below.

recovery phrase for kahof-tahag: istox-eliael-istath